Ralpha Painter is from Bethalto, Illinois. After graduating from Lincoln Christian University and attending Lincoln Christian Seminary, she became a teacher in Puerto Rico. She married there and she and her husband, "Paco" have raised 4 beautiful children. Her husband died in July of this year. He was a VietNam veteran who earned the Purple Heart. This campaign is being set up for Ralpha to have the necessary funds to rebuild the roof of their home. The entire home is cement walls. Half of the roof is wood covered in tin and half is cement. Hurricane George damaged the tin side and now Hurricane Maria has destroyed it again. The kitchen and at least one bedroom have been severely water damaged as well. The specific need is to rebuild the wood/tin side with CEMENT! This will provide a more sure protection in the future. It will cost approximately $3,000. Any and all monies collected will be useful towards the roof, food/water/gasoline and kitchen cabinetry replacement. It is estimated to be a 2-month wait before there will be help in construction workers and supplies getting inland.
